But if we uncomment the first static_assert - it evaluates to false. Mind you: Not because struct inner is incomplete; it is simply deeme= d to not be default-constructible. But - it _is_ default constructible. And if we add a method to struct outer which default-constructs an inner, it will wor= k. Also note that if we uncomment the explicit default ctor the definition of struct inner, both asserts pass. clang++ seems to exhibit this too (also with -stdlib=3Dlibc++). I'm not sure whether this is an actual bug in the library, or whether the standard manda= tes this in some freakish way, but - it's just wrong.=
